Overview of High School
Founded in 1916, West Catholic Preparatory High School has enjoyed a rich history of preparing young people to be competitive in the college setting and the career world. The challenging academic curriculum, competitive athletics program and engaging activities complement each other to foster courage, character and leadership.
West Catholic Preparatory High School Mission Statement
West Catholic Preparatory High School is a Catholic community of academic excellence in an urban environment that is open to an interdenominational population. The school’s rigorous spiritual, academic, technological, and co-curricular programs develop our ethnically and religiously diverse student body into young men and women of strong moral and ethical character. West Catholic prepares each student to face the challenges of everyday life in an ever- changing global society.

Position Summary:
The Assistant Director of Admissions supports the Director of Admissions in recruiting, enrolling, and retaining students while advancing the mission and Lasallian values of West Catholic Preparatory High School. This position serves as a key member of the Admissions Office by providing exceptional customer service, coordinating admissions events, managing applicant records, building relationships with prospective families and partner schools, and assisting with enrollment initiatives to achieve the school’s strategic enrollment goals.
Essential Responsibilities
Admissions & Enrollment- Request transcripts, report cards, attendance, conduct records, and standardized test scores from sending schools.
- Update and maintain accurate applicant records in SchoolAdmin.
- Monitor application completion and communicate next steps with families.
- Recruit, train, and coordinate Student Ambassadors for admissions events and campus visits.
- Create, organize, and maintain student admissions files and documentation.
- Assist with processing admissions applications from inquiry through enrollment.
- Follow up with applicants and families regarding missing admissions documents.
Recruitment & Outreach- Schedule and coordinate student shadow days (Burr for a Day).
- Coordinate and conduct campus tours for prospective students and families (Wednesdays at West)
- Build and maintain positive relationships with feeder schools and community organizations.
- Visit elementary and middle schools to recruit prospective students.
- Represent West Catholic at high school fairs, parish events, and community recruitment programs.
- Promote West Catholic through outreach initiatives and recruitment events.
